Strategic Position
Zenas BioPharma, Inc. is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on developing and commercializing immune-based therapies for autoimmune and rare diseases. The company's pipeline includes novel biologics targeting immune dysregulation, with a primary focus on autoimmune conditions such as syst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) and other inflammatory diseases. Zenas BioPharma leverages a combination of in-house research and strategic collaborations to advance its therapeutic candidates. The company's competitive advantage lies in its targeted approach to modulating the immune system, aiming to address unmet medical needs in niche autoimmune and rare disease markets.

Key Risks
- Regulatory: As a clinical-stage biopharma company, Zenas faces inherent regulatory risks, including potential delays or rejections in clinical trials and approvals by agencies such as the FDA or EMA.
- Competitive: The autoimmune and rare disease space is highly competitive, with larger biopharma companies and well-funded startups developing similar therapies. Zenas may face challenges in differentiating its candidates.
- Financial: Zenas BioPharma is likely pre-revenue, relying on funding from investors or partnerships to sustain operations. Its financial stability depends on successful capital raises or milestone payments from collaborations.
- Operational: As a small biotech, Zenas may face operational risks related to clinical trial execution, supply chain management, and talent retention.
